What is Guttering?

Guttering refers to the collection system that directs rainwater from the roof to appropriate drainage areas, generally by means of downspouts. Wetness collected in gutters can prevent issues like soil disintegration, basement flooding, and water damage to the exterior of a home.

Kinds of Guttering

Not all guttering systems are developed equal. Picking the best type for a home depends upon various elements such as climate, architecture, and personal preferences. Below are some standard types of guttering:

TypeDescriptionProsCons
K-style GuttersShaped like the letter "K," these are the most common type.Pleasing look; simple to mount.Prone to obstructions.
Half-Round GuttersSemi-circular fit, typically used in older or historical homes.Aesthetically pleasing; efficient.More costly to set up.
Box GuttersA square or rectangle-shaped profile, constructed into the roofline.Suitable for flat roofing systems; less visible.Needs maintenance; possible leakages.
Seamless GuttersMade from a single piece of material, personalized on-site.Minimizes leaks; low maintenance.Can be pricey at first.

Maintenance of Guttering Systems

To make sure optimum effectiveness, routine maintenance of guttering systems is crucial. Here are some efficient maintenance suggestions:

  1. Regular Cleaning: Clean gutters a minimum of two times a year to prevent clogs triggered by leaves, dirt, and particles.

  2. Examine for Damage: Regularly check for rust, damages, or leaks to guarantee appropriate function. Look for indications of wear and replace damaged sections quickly.

  3. Examine Downspouts: Ensure downspouts direct water far from the structure. Usage extensions if required to lead water even more away.

  4. Flush with Water: After cleaning, flush the gutter system with water to look for correct drainage.

  5. Set Up Gutter Guards: Consider installing Gutter Protection guards to minimize debris build-up and decrease maintenance requirements.

Local Guttering FAQs

1. How often should gutters be cleaned?

Response: It is suggested to tidy gutters at least twice a year-- once in the spring and once in the fall. Nevertheless, if you reside in an area with a lot of trees, you may need to do it more often.

2. What can take place if I neglect my gutter maintenance?

Response: Neglecting gutters can result in water damage, consisting of rotting wood, mold development, and an unstable structure. Furthermore, it can likewise cause pricey repairs in the long run.

3. Do I need a professional for gutter installation?

Answer: While some house owners go with a DIY installation, working with a professional ensures correct installation and decreases the risk of future concerns.

4. What is the distinction in between seamless and sectional gutters?

Answer: Seamless gutters are made from a single piece of product and decrease leaks. Sectional gutters are put together from pre-formed sections and are more prone to leaks.

5. How do I know if my gutters need changing?

Answer: Signs that homeowners might need new gutters include considerable rust or corrosion, warping, fractures, and frequent clogs or Local Guttering Experts Near Me (https://fancypad.techinc.nl) overflow.
